Frequently Asked Questions
1. WHAT DOES IT TAKE TO BE A SPECIAL INSPECTOR?
Special inspectors must possess certain qualifications in order to carry out their responsibilities. These qualifications vary depending on the type of work being inspected; for example, an inspector may need to be certified in welding or fireproofing if they are inspecting those types of projects. In addition to certifications or licenses, special inspectors also need extensive knowledge of local and national building codes, as well as strong communication skills so they can effectively communicate with other professionals on the job site.
2. HOW CAN A SPECIAL INSPECTOR HELP YOU?
By having a special inspector on your project team, you can rest assured knowing that any potential problems will be identified quickly so corrective measures can be taken right away. This helps to ensure that your project stays on track and within budget, while meeting all safety requirements. In addition, special inspectors can review documents such as construction drawings and shop drawings to make sure that they conform with the plans specified by architects or engineers. This helps prevent costly mistakes from occurring down the line.
